I've been lifting for over a year with a pair of KSwiss similar to these: Invalid Link Removed
When I squat I notice my knees wabble - not very stable.

I also have a pair of Adidas wrestling shoes similar to these: Invalid Link Removed
Mine don't have the velcro strap. I'm going to give these a try next time I squat and see if I get better results.
 
Olympic weightlifting shoes work wonders. I have a pair of last years Addidas Adistar.. love em
 
Everyone, thanks for the info on shoes!

I took my pair of wrestling shoes to the gym yesterday since it was leg day. The flatter soles made a huge difference, in fact I was able to add an extra 40 lbs to my squat without having my knees wiggle all over the place.
